Output 6fa21cc26c4aed2429bac91520e9a2288311ce0e8cc3bfd4ce10f7604cb7c521:3

value
24850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8694584a290d8e7d72593fb88c043d414e22cfe OP_EQUAL
address
3MRHzNhmCLLAPY5jnNqeGxNLHfR2wWcH9o
transaction
6fa21cc26c4aed2429bac91520e9a2288311ce0e8cc3bfd4ce10f7604cb7c521
spent
true